Mat Barzal to face possible discipline for interfering with player on the ice from the bench
Tonight marked the end of the New York Islanders' playoff hopes. It also marked the Toronto Maple Leafs setting franchise records for both wins and points in a single season. But there is another play from the game that appears to be drawing interest.
During the 3rd period, while Mitch Marner stood in front of the Islanders' bench, Mat Barzal reached out and grabbed Marner's jersey. The grab on Marner's jersey prevented him from getting involved in the play as he wanted.
While the play is seemingly harmless it's likely to draw the attention of NHL Player Safety. Earlier this year Jamie Benn was fined $5,000 for spraying water onto a player from the bench.
After the game Mitch Marner was asked about the incident and had the following to say about the matter:
Hopefully he gets fined for that, that would be great.
The likeliest outcome would be for Barzal to receive a fine for this play, but in my opinion a $5,000 fine doesn't do enough to discourage this behavior in the future. If a $5,000 fine is the baseline for this action, what's to stop a player from performing similar action in a key playoff game?
